MailUp for WooCommerce

Description

Collect leads of interest on specific products or topics by inserting buttons and registration forms on the pages of your WordPress site, choosing the correct list and group of MailUp.
Add your customers to different MailUp recipient groups automatically, based on the WooCommerce products purchased.
Prepare the workflows needed to follow your customer before and after the purchase in MailUp.

Functionlities

  • Add a newsletter subscription flag in your site registration form
  • Choose which list and MailUp group to add your users to
  • Send the MailUp confirmation email for registration to the newsletter
  • Add MailUp subscription buttons and forms to the WordPress post-types of your interest
  • Place the sign up button and form before or after the page content or wherever you prefer using a shortcode
  • Choose the text of the MailUp subscription button
  • Choose the text thanking the user for subscribing to MailUp
  • (Premium) Choose whether to show visitors the WordPress login/registration form or simply request their name and email
  • (Premium) Select the page with the Privacy Policy to show to the user
  • (Premium) Add a text description before the MailUp subscription form/button
  • (Premium) Choose a page on your site to be redirected after registering with MailUp
  • (Premium) Select a MailUp list and group for each WooCommerce product

Installation

From your WordPress dashboard

  • Visit Plugins > Add New.
  • Search for MailUp for WooCommerce and download it.
  • Activate MailUp for WooCommerce from your Plugins page.
  • Once Activated, go to MailUp for WC menu and set you preferences.

From WordPress.org

  • Download MailUp for WooCommerce
  • Upload the ‘mailup-for-woocommerce’ directory to your ‘/wp-content/plugins/’ directory, using your favorite method (ftp, sftp, scp, etc…)
  • Activate MailUp for WooCommerce from your Plugins page.
  • Once Activated, go to MailUp for WC menu and set you preferences.
